Rugby Town Overview - Rugby is a historic market town located in the county of Warwickshire, England. Best known as the birthplace of the sport of rugby football, the town is steeped in heritage and character. It lies on the eastern edge of Warwickshire, near the borders of Northamptonshire and Leicestershire, and is well connected by road and rail, including a major railway junction on the West Coast Main Line.
One of the town's most iconic landmarks is Rugby School, founded in 1567, which gained international fame thanks to the legend of William Webb Ellis—said to have invented the game of rugby by picking up a football and running with it during a match in 1823. Today, the school continues to play a central role in the town's identity.
Beyond its sporting legacy, Rugby has a rich industrial history, particularly in engineering and railways, and it grew significantly during the 19th century. Modern Rugby combines its heritage with a vibrant town centre, green open spaces like Caldecott Park, and a range of amenities and cultural offerings.
Rugby is also known for its diverse community and serves as an important economic and transport hub in the region. Whether for its contributions to sport, its historic architecture, or its dynamic community, Rugby holds a unique place in both local and national history.

Important Information (Legal Aspects) - To secure a property, a holding fee equivalent to one week’s rent is required. This amount will be deducted from your first month's rent upon moving in. Once the holding fee is paid, the property will be removed from the market while references are processed. You must take possession of the property within 14 days unless otherwise agreed. Please note that the holding fee is non-refundable in the following circumstances:
- If you provided false information that results in a failed credit check (such as having County Court Judgements, an IVA, or a bankruptcy),
- If any information you supplied is incorrect, or
- If you change your mind.
Additionally, a security deposit equal to five weeks' rent will be required. Default charges include:
- Interest on rent arrears, which may be charged at a maximum of 3% above the Bank of England base rate, applicable only once the rent is more than 14 days late,
- A change of sharer fee, capped at £50 including VAT.
Should early termination of the agreement be permitted, you will be responsible for the landlord’s costs related to re-letting the property. Cadman Homes’ client money protection policy number is 0177250 via UKALA. More information can be found at .
